description 碩士 === 國立交通大學 === 經營管理研究所 === 93 === ABSTRACT This thesis studies twenty-seven listed or OTC biotech firms in Taiwan during the period from 1998 to 2003. These biotech firms are categorized into biotech-medical, biotech-instrument, and biotech-food firms. Data envelopment analysis (DEA) is used to measure the productivity and efficiency of these biotech firms. The regression method then is used to estimate the effects of technical and efficiency growth rates on the sales revenue growth rate. Our major empirical results are as follows: (1) Most of the biotech firms were at increasing-returns-to-scale (IRS) stage of production during the research period. (2) Technical efficiency of these biotech firms improved year by year. (3) Accumulative technical growth rate of biotech-instrument firms was growing but that of biotech-food firms was falling. (4) Biotech-medical firms’ sales growth was mainly due to technical growth. (5) Biotech-instrument and biotech-food firms’ sales growth was mainly due to technical and efficiency growths.
